Usage AM or PM: Apply a large pearl sized amount and massage into dry skin until gel liquefies and pilling occurs. Leave on 5-15 mins. Remove with a damp cloth using a gentle, sweeping action. Follow with serums and moisturiser.

Tip: For sensitive skin, apply and do not massage.

The Aspect Fruit Enzyme Mask is a gel-based exfoliating treatment designed to support gentle skin renewal using fruit-derived enzymes rather than harsh physical scrubs. Ingredients sourced from fruits such as pineapple, grapefruit, pomegranate, acai, and cranberry help loosen surface buildup by breaking down dead skin cells, promoting a smoother and more refined appearance. Enzyme exfoliation works at the surface level, making it suitable for maintaining skin clarity while supporting barrier function when used appropriately. Antioxidant-rich extracts also provide protection against environmental stressors that contribute to dullness. The mask functions as an exfoliating gel treatment through a texture that transforms during application. When massaged onto dry skin, the gel softens and begins to liquefy, helping distribute fruit enzymes evenly across the surface. This process assists in loosening dead skin cells and impurities, which may appear as a gentle “pilling” effect during massage. Unlike abrasive scrubs, enzyme exfoliation supports renewal without excessive friction, helping preserve barrier function while refining skin texture. After allowing the treatment to sit briefly, the product is removed with water or a damp cloth, leaving the skin feeling smoother and refreshed. The Aspect Fruit Enzyme Mask is generally suitable for a wide range of skin types, including normal, oily, combination, dry, and mature skin. It is particularly helpful for individuals experiencing dullness, uneven texture, or congestion caused by accumulated surface buildup. Enzyme exfoliation provides a gentler alternative to stronger chemical or physical exfoliants, making it appropriate for regular maintenance within a balanced routine. The mask is typically used once or twice per week as a renewal-focused treatment step. Frequency may be adjusted depending on skin sensitivity and overall skincare routine, helping maintain clarity and smoothness without overstimulating inflammatory pathways associated with over-exfoliation. Apply a pearl-sized amount to clean, dry skin and gently massage to activate the gel texture, allowing fruit enzymes to distribute evenly. As the formula liquefies, continue light massage until the characteristic pilling effect appears, then leave the mask on for approximately 5–15 minutes depending on comfort and skin tolerance. Remove using a damp cloth with gentle sweeping motions, avoiding excessive rubbing. For sensitive skin, the mask may be applied without massage to minimise stimulation while still receiving enzyme benefits. Following removal, apply hydrating products to support barrier function and restore moisture balance. Always use sunscreen during daytime routines after exfoliation treatments.
